At Thursday's Senate Approrpiations Committee hearing, Sen. John Kennedy (R-LA) questioned FBI Dir. Kash Patel about the arrest of Wisconsin Judge Hannah Dugan.
Transcript
00:00Mr. Director, worry not, we'll make sure your agency is adequately funded.
00:08This judge you arrested in Wisconsin, she was breaking federal law, wasn't she?
00:19Yes, that's why we arrested her.
00:21She was helping an illegal immigrant escape being taken into custody, is that right?
00:30Yes, and the field agents decided to open the case, work the case.
00:33And as Americans, do we get to pick and choose which laws we want to follow?
00:38We do not.
00:39If you're a state court judge, do you get to decide you don't want to follow federal law?
00:44No.
00:45And if you violate federal law, you get arrested, don't you?
00:51Yes, Senator.
